Re: Essential modules are missing, downloading cannot start.
My guess is that the sabctools 7.1.2 is in /usr/local/lib/python3.10/dist-packages/sabctools/ or maybe in /us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/sabctools/
There are clever tools to find that out, but I'm not good at them.
and
A brute force method to solve it, is uninstalling python3-sabctools a few times, and then verify there is no python module sabctools anymore.
Oh, and if you installed sabctools via pip, then also uninstall via pip.
